What is the UFO Test?
The UFO test is a classic tool for assessing motion blur, ghosting, and pixel response time on displays. Watch the UFO move across the screen to identify trailing, smearing, or double images that indicate slow pixel transitions.
Start the test and observe the UFO as it moves. Try different speeds and backgrounds to see how your display handles fast motion. A high-quality display will show a crisp, clear UFO with minimal trailing.

What to Look For
- •Motion Blur: Does the UFO appear blurry or smeared while moving? This indicates slow pixel response times.
- •Ghosting: Do you see multiple copies or ghost images of the UFO? This is called inverse ghosting or pixel overshoot.
- •Trailing: Does the UFO leave a visible trail behind it? This indicates poor pixel response and transition times.
Tips for Best Results
- ✓ Test at different speeds - faster speeds make motion blur more obvious
- ✓ Try different backgrounds - dark backgrounds make trailing more visible
- ✓ Sit at your normal viewing distance for accurate assessment
- ✓ Compare results with different monitor settings (overdrive, response time mode)
